Correction: The AirPort Extreme card can't. The normal AirPort card
can. Most 3rd party USB/PCMCIA ones can on Macs with the supported
chipsets. And it's RFMon mode, not promiscuous mode. Promiscuous mode
is getting all the packets on a network. RFmon mode is getting all
the packets from every network.

I am wondering which settings I need to be attentive to so I can
ensure I don't get outsiders surfing or exploring on my bandwidth.
The bad news it, its pretty trivial for anyone to do anything, no
matter what security you set. It used to take 100k packets or so
for them to be able to decrypt the WEP encoding but new software
can usually do it in a few seconds now.
MAC address restrictions are fine but if someone has their card in
promiscuous mode, they can see what MAC addresses are being allowed
'cos that part is sent in the clear, outside of any WEP
encryption. And then they just clone the address of someone who is
allowed.
Mac users are at a disadvantage for hacking into other peoples'
base stations, the Airport card cannot be put into a promiscous
mode (where it reads and records all traffic) unlike regular
cards. so if your neighbors are al Mac users, turn on MAC address
filtering and you are free from them, anyway :)
I use MAC address filtering, without WEP, and figure it's good
enough. If someone wanted in, or to snoop, they are in, I just
make it a little hard for regular folks and it's enough to keep
most out.
IMO the most important thing for you to do for real security is
make sure your base station has "remote administration" turned off;
so people on the wired internet cannot try and telnet into it (and
believe me, they will). Setting up MAC filtering or WEP is helpful
but not really that protective.
